The Industry
Theme Park is a large entertainment area and has variety complexes with theme in each of its complex. Theme Park is a global Industry operating in North America, Europe and Asia with attendance from local area and from all over the world. Theme park become necessity for the people to get entertainment and leisure after busy working day, especially for family. The reason that people come to theme park is the ride that delight them to visit again.
Needs Analysis
The needs of this entertainment industry is increasing year after year as the attendance of amusement park on Farmland is increasing at 5.113 thousand in 1993, that show us that there is growth in the Market. (table 4).
From table 8. The need of the theme park for the south Korean consumer place a rate of 22%, it shows the need
Korean people work for 5 and a half days every week, that indicate that they are very busy, and seems that they have no time for going to the theme park, but in the other hand if we provide a good theme park we can deliver the need of leisure for them after the busy work.
In the worldwide, this business is already mature, so we have to arrive with a concept that distinct our theme park with the other theme park, therefore we can attract global market to our theme park.
The influencer of the needs: * Family : Spouse, Children, Parents, media promotion * Single : Friends, Colleague , social membership, media promotion

5 FORCES ANALYSIS
Competitive Rivalry within Theme Park Industry : HIGH
Local Rivalry
There are 6 amusement park industry in Korea and Lotte world and Seoul Land are the closest competitor. Lotte world is stated themselves as the biggest Indoor Theme Park in the world and they are located at downtown, which is one of the key success in the business with the accessibility.

    Ever since the beginning of the 1970s, Disney World has become an influential blueprint that many companies have used do business in society. Disney World has many different techniques and ideas that have allowed them to produce maximum gain in all facets of society. This is known as ‘Disneyization, ' "the process by which the principles of the Disney theme parks are coming to dominate more and more sectors of American society as well as the rest of the world" (Bryman, 1999, p. 26). Disneyization is broken up into five separate principles: spectacularization, theming, dedifferentiation of consumption, merchandising, and emotional labor. These principles have been adopted by companies all around the world and have been thrown into full practice today in our society.…

    Lotte World opened on July 12, 1989, starting the era of full-scale theme parks in Korea. It was registered in the Guinness World Records as the largest indoor theme park in the world on 1995. Moreover, it is regarded as one of the world’s best theme parks along with Disneyland in the US and Japan (one of the world’s TOP 10 theme parks selected by Forbes Magazine). The theme park total is 128,246㎡. It is visited by over 8 million customers on the average in a year.…
